Yup, I’ve heard the DWM panels. They were never offered as a subwoofer, but rather as additional woofers, to help bring up the level of the Magnepan speaker’s bottom end as it dropped off (due to a couple reasons, including dipole cancellation). I’ve always considered them over-priced for the little bass reinforcement they afford.

I don't think anyone was questioning the quality of a four-woofer array. The research demonstrating that is well known, and as I said, a speaker designer I know (who played a role in the development of the new Maggie) compared four sealed woofers with two planar woofers and found their quality comparable.

I'd point out, though, that the new woofer is *not* a DWM, or a planar woofer at all. It's a dynamic dipole woofer that has response similar to the response of the 30.7's bass panels. Which is to say it isn't a sub, but neither is it a DWM, which is designed to reinforce the midbass and has limited output. It's designed to be small and easy to hide, though the woofers can be stacked in a large room.

(I wonder what happens when you use four dipole woofers in an array? It could potentially be smoother than either four monopoles or two dipoles!)

Josh, what Danny Richie (GR Research) uses at shows is a pair of OB/Dipole subs at the front of the room (phase aligned with the loudspeakers), and a pair of sealed monopoles (his F12G model) at the rear, which their phase opposite the fronts. That system won him the "Best Bass At The Show " award at a number of RMAF.

The challenge in creating a swarm using all OB/Dipoles, is that the H-frame, like all dipoles, must be at least 3’ from all walls, and face the listening position. On each side of the sub there is of course the dipole null, so while the sub will pump bass energy into the room, it will do so only out of it’s front and rear, not it’s sides. Could be tricky!

Another way to go, is to use a pair of OB/Dipoles as woofers/subs for the speakers, and augment them, as does Danny Richie, with a pair of sealed subs, positioned in the room ala a swarm, to deal with room modes, etc.

     I know from experience that good bass performance is much more difficult to get sounding right than the midrange, treble and imaging in most rooms.  This is mainly due to the bass soundwaves being much longer and behaving very differently in typical rooms than the much shorter and directional midrange and treble soundwaves.
     Because of this, I prefer to treat my system as 2 systems: a bass system and an everything else system.  Once I get the bass sounding optimum, it's relatively easy positioning the main speakers optimally in relation to my head and ears at the designated listening seat for very good midrange and treble performance along with a wide, deep and 3 dimensional soundstage illusion with solid, stable and natural images.

     I've been thinking about this and I do recall Duke stating on another thread that he thought that a 4-sub line source bass array system would probably outperform his 4-sub distributed bass array system.  This member did have a pair of Eminent Technology dipole planar-magnetic speakers.
      This member had an odd room, where there wasn't a typical rear wall that bass soundwaves would normally reflect off of causing bass issues.  Instead of a wall existing behind his designated listening seat, there was another room with the far wall in that room being a large distance away.
      This member had 4 large subs aligned along his front 16' wall in a line or row, with all the subs less than 4' apart.  He and Duke seemed to agree that, because there was no traditional rear wall and the 4 subs were aligned in a row with all being less than 4' apart, this constituted what's called a 4-sub bass line array. 
      Basically in this 4-sub bass line array, all 4 subs act as one giant sub and big bass soundwaves that are as wide as the room are effectively created that travel directly to the listening seat.  If there's no wall directly behind the listening seat to reflect off of , the bass is perceived as very powerful, accurate, detailed and dynamic.  
     So, I believe Duke was stating that a 4-sub bass line array can outperform his 4-sub DBA if your room effectively has no rear wall for bass soundwaves to reflect off of, which I think you agree is highly unlikely for most individuals' rooms.
